ELD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review
76 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in WisdomTree Emerging Markets Local Debt Fund (ELD)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$86.8M — down 42% from $149M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 13 funds closed out of ELD and 9 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 28 trimmed existing stakes and 21 added.
The largest buyer was SEI Investments, adding an estimated $2.67M. The largest seller was Valmark Advisers, cutting an estimated $38.9M.
